Drug release refers back to the method by which the Lively substances within a medication are released from its formulation to the bloodstream.
Sustained release (SR) refers to your formulation of the drug that is certainly built to release the Lively component little by little around an extended period. This process permits a gentle concentration from the medication inside the bloodstream, which often can make improvements to its effectiveness and decrease the frequency of dosing.

The next layer contains a drug contained in a film or adhesive. The membrane is a thin movie that controls the diffusion fee with the drug within the patch towards the skin. The adhesive layer aids the patch adhere to your pores and skin [18]. Like a useful layer or outer lining, the film-coated tape is straight integrated in to the patch style. The release liner protects the sticky side from the patch which will probably be in connection with the skin which is removed ahead of making use of the patch into the pores and skin [19].

Best mucoadhesive polymers quickly adhere to mucosal levels with no interfering with drug release, are biodegradable and non-harmful, and greatly enhance drug penetration at delivery websites. The mechanisms of bioadhesion require wetting, swelling, interpenetration and entanglement of polymer chains followed by secondary bonding formations.
